Parrot feathers contain red, orange, and yellow polyene pigments called psittacofulvins. Genome-wide association mapping and gene-expression analysis mapped the Mendelian blue locus, which abolishes yellow pigmentation in the budgerigar. The blue trait maps to a single amino acid substitution (R644W) in an uncharacterized polyketide synthase (MuPKS) gene. When the MuPKS gene is expressed in yeast, yellow pigments accumulated. Mass spectrometry confirmed the yellow pigments matched those in feathers. The R644W substitution abolished MuPKS gene activity. Furthermore, gene-expression data from feathers of different bird species suggest that parrots acquired their colors through regulatory changes that drive high expression of the MuPKS gene in feather epithelia. This formulates biochemical models that explain natural color variation in parrots.
The Blue mutation provides a widely accepted division of domesticated budgerigars into two colour classes: the "Green series" and the "Blue series". Birds of the Green series exhibit yellow pigmentation, while birds of the Blue series lack yellow pigmentation. These names can be misleading, since some birds belonging to the Blue series, such as Albinos, are not blue; similarly, Lutinos belong to the Green series, yet are not green.

Historical notes
The Blue mutation
made its first recorded appearance in 1878
[Watmough (1951), p 14] in the aviaries of M Limbosch of

The first Blues to be seen in England were some exhibited by Messrs Millsum and Pauwels at the Horticultural Hall in 1910 and the Crystal Palace in 1911.
Mr D Astley owned Blues in 1911,

Blues remained quite rare until the 1930s, fetching up to £100 per pair in
